Battle of Dry Creek
Reenactment of 1863 Civil War Battle near White Sulphur Springs. Realistic portrayals of cavalry attacks, infantry skirmishes, and artillery duels between Confederate and Union armies. Live fire of cannons at targets, live band and dance on Saturday night. Night firing of cannons. Battles both days. Bleachers set up for public.
